Read-only diagnostics

Baseline diagnostics before changing What Is a Web Shell? Types and Detection

These commands are primarily read-only health/status checks. Redact IPs, users, tokens, domains and secrets before sharing output.

Command 1
date -Is
Command 2
who
Command 3
last -ai | head -n 30
Command 4
ss -lntup
Command 5
ps aux --sort=-%cpu | head -n 20
Command 6
find /tmp /var/tmp -type f -mtime -2 -ls 2>/dev/null | head

Research dossier

Technical points users most often need to resolve

The first objective is not to chase the attacker but to preserve evidence, isolate the system, determine scope and compare against known-good sources.

01

Rotate credentials from a known-good device; generating new secrets on a compromised host can expose them again.

02

After cleanup, watch Search Console, logs, WAF and file-integrity signals for recurrence over several days.

03

There may be no single 'attacker IP'; proxies/CDNs, stolen credentials, web exploits and lateral movement complicate attribution.

04

Volatile evidence may need capture before isolation; aggressive scanning/deletion on a live system can damage evidence and uptime.

05

File mtime alone is not evidence; correlate hashes, owners, paths, web logs and package integrity.
